Output fecb22af3331c59ec807d240ac40e4bcb3a79b8a1dd98a361adb2c20995153cb:0

value
23331
script pubkey
OP_0 OP_PUSHBYTES_20 84d6ff4972ce3dfb98c84881345254d058aaca56
address
bc1qsnt07jtjec7lhxxgfzqng5j56pv24jjkl278fa
transaction
fecb22af3331c59ec807d240ac40e4bcb3a79b8a1dd98a361adb2c20995153cb
confirmations
47327
spent
true